My Buying Guides on Wrought Iron Stair Balusters
What I Look for First
When I shop for wrought iron stair balusters, I first focus on safety, style, and fit. I want balusters that support the staircase properly, match the look of my home, and meet any local building requirements. In my experience, starting with these basics saves time and helps me avoid costly mistakes.
Material Quality
I always check the quality of the wrought iron before buying. I prefer balusters that feel solid, have a smooth finish, and show no signs of weak welding or rough edges. Good-quality wrought iron lasts longer and resists bending, which matters a lot in a high-traffic area like stairs.
Design and Style
For me, the design has to complement the rest of the home. I look at whether I want a simple classic style, decorative scrollwork, or a more modern look. I have found that the right baluster design can completely change the appearance of a staircase, so I choose carefully.
Size and Compatibility
I always measure my staircase before ordering. The height, spacing, and thickness of the balusters must match the handrail and tread layout. If the size is off, installation becomes frustrating and the finished look may not be even. I also make sure the balusters are compatible with the mounting method I plan to use.
Finish and Coating
I pay close attention to the finish because it affects both appearance and durability. Powder-coated or properly painted balusters usually hold up better against rust and wear. I prefer finishes that are easy to clean and maintain, especially if the staircase gets a lot of use.
Installation Considerations
I like to think about installation before I buy. Some balusters are easier to install than others, depending on whether they use screws, epoxy, or welds. If I want a smoother project, I choose balusters that come with clear instructions and the necessary hardware.
Safety and Building Codes
Safety is always a priority for me. I make sure the balusters meet local code requirements for spacing and height so children and pets cannot slip through. I never skip this step, because even a beautiful staircase is not worth the risk if it is not safe.
Budget and Value
I compare prices, but I do not choose based on cost alone. In my experience, the cheapest option is not always the best value. I look for balusters that balance durability, appearance, and price so I get a product that lasts without overspending.
Maintenance Needs
I also consider how much upkeep I am willing to do. Some finishes need occasional cleaning and touch-ups, while others are more low-maintenance. I prefer options that keep their look with minimal effort, especially for busy households.
